Abstract

Purpose

This paper aims at studying numerically the entropy generation of nanofluid flowing over an inclined sheet in the presence of external magnetic field, heat source/sink, chemical reaction along with slip boundary conditions imposed on an impermeable wall.

Design/methodology/approach

A suitable similarity transformation technique has been used to convert the coupled nonlinear partial differential equations to ordinary differential equations (ODEs). The ODEs are then solved simultaneously using the finite difference method implemented through an in-house computer program. The effects of different controlling parameters such as magnetic parameter, radiation parameter, Brownian motion parameter, thermophoresis parameter, chemical reaction parameter, Reynolds number, Brinkmann number, Prandtl number, velocity slip parameter, temperature slip parameter and the concentration slip parameter on the entropy generation and Bejan number have been discussed comprehensively through the relevant physical insights for the first time.

Findings

The relative strengths of the irreversibilities due to heat transfer, fluid friction and the mass diffusion arising due to the change in each of the controlling variables have been delineated both in the near-wall and far-away-wall regions, which may be helpful for a better understanding of the thermo-fluid dynamics of nanofluid in boundary layer flows. The numerical results obtained from the present study have also been validated with results published in open literature.

Abstract

Purpose

This study aims to verify the significance of Andersen (2008) corporate risk management (CRM) framework in Asian emerging markets (AEMs) to control firm risk and improve firm performance.

Design/methodology/approach

The cross-sectional analyses are performed on a sample of 4,609 firms across nine Asian emerging countries using 2SLS estimation technique.

Findings

The empirical findings show that the adoption of CRM not only enhances firm performance by increasing the firm ability to capitalize on the market opportunity but also plays a significant role in reducing firm risk. The findings of this study assert that by institutionalizing risk management practices into an integrated CRM framework, the firm can reap multiple benefits by maintaining better contractual agreements and strategic partnerships with key stakeholders.

Originality/value

The study shifts the focus of CRM away from Western countries toward AEMs, which has been afflicted by high risks and uncertainties. The effectiveness of CRM against firm risk is established by dividing firm risk into firm-specific risk and systematic risk. Furthermore, this study also establishes that CRM not only leads to high returns but also reduces firm operational and production costs. Overall, the study provides a compelling argument to implement CRM for improving organizational performance and managing risks in a strategic and integrated manner. The findings are also relevant to risk management practitioners, as well as to academicians interested in the broader fields of corporate finance and strategy.

Abstract

Purpose

The purpose of this study is to identify the risks that exist in halal meat supply chain activities and to carry out a risk assessment using the fuzzy best-worst method (FBWM) along with mitigating risks using the risk mitigation number (RMN).

Design/methodology/approach

The method used is to collect several literature reviews related to the halal meat supply chain, which has information relevant to the risks of the meat industry in Indonesia. Then, a focus group discussion was held with several experts who play a role in the meat industry in Indonesia, and 33 identified risks were identified in halal meat supply chain activities. The proposed methodology uses FBWM and RMN in conducting risk assessment and mitigation in the meat industry in Indonesia.

Findings

The analysis reveals that priority risk is obtained by using the global weight value on the FBWM, and then risk mitigation is carried out with RMN. Priority mitigation strategies can mitigate some of the risks to the meat industry in Indonesia. The proposed mitigation strategy is designed to be more effective and efficient in preventing risks that can interfere with product halalness in halal meat supply chain activities in the Indonesian meat industry.

Research limitations/implications

The implications of this study highlight the need for collaboration among stakeholders, improved risk assessment methodologies and the expansion of research into other halal supply chains. By addressing these implications, the halal industry can enhance its integrity, consumer confidence and overall contribution to the global market.

Originality/value

This research provides an integrated approach to identifying, analyzing, assessing and mitigating risks to the meat industry in Indonesia.

Abstract

Purpose

A parabolic trough solar collector is an advanced concentrated solar power technology that significantly captures radiant energy. Solar power will help different sectors reach their energy needs in areas where traditional fuels are in use. This study aims to examine the sensitivity analysis for optimizing the heat transfer and entropy generation in the Jeffrey magnetohydrodynamic hybrid nanofluid flow under the influence of motile gyrotactic microorganisms with solar radiation in the parabolic trough solar collectors. The influences of viscous dissipation and Ohmic heating are also considered in this investigation.

Design/methodology/approach

Governing partial differential equations are derived via boundary layer assumptions and nondimensionalized with the help of suitable similarity transformations. The resulting higher-order coupled ordinary differential equations are numerically investigated using the Runga-Kutta fourth-order numerical approach with the shooting technique in the computational MATLAB tool.

Findings

The numerical outcomes of influential parameters are presented graphically for velocity, temperature, entropy generation, Bejan number, drag coefficient and Nusselt number. It is observed that escalating the values of melting heat parameter and the Prandl number enhances the Nusselt number, while reverse effect is observed with an enhancement in the magnetic field parameter and bioconvection Lewis number. Increasing the magnetic field and bioconvection diffusion parameter improves the entropy and Bejan number.

Originality/value

Nanotechnology has captured the interest of researchers due to its engrossing performance and wide range of applications in heat transfer and solar energy storage. There are numerous advantages of hybrid nanofluids over traditional heat transfer fluids. In addition, the upswing suspension of the motile gyrotactic microorganisms improves the hybrid nanofluid stability, enhancing the performance of the solar collector. The use of solar energy reduces the industry’s dependency on fossil fuels.

Abstract

Purpose

The purpose of this study is to examine and review tayyiban indicators in the context of halal food production. In Islam, food produced or manufactured must be halal and tayyiban. Even though both halal and tayyiban are always mentioned together in the Quran, the halal aspect is highlighted more than tayyiban. The discussion of tayyiban’s indicators is still vague.

Design/methodology/approach

The study was adopted based on the Preferred Reporting Items for Systematic Reviews and Meta-Analyses for the review of the current research which used two main journal databases, namely, Web of Science and Scopus. Accordingly, the search resulted in a total of 40 articles that can be systematically examined.

Findings

The results of review of these articles formulated five main themes: safety, nutrition, cleanliness, quality and authenticity. These five indicators are considered relevant enough in the context of halal food production to build a comprehensive tayyiban concept.

Originality/value

This study enriches the field of halal food research. The concept of tayyiban as a whole has been given limited attention in academic literature. At the end of this study, a number of recommendations are suggested for the reference of future scholars.

Abstract

Purpose

Cloud computing gives several on-demand infrastructural services by dynamically pooling heterogeneous resources to cater to users’ applications. The task scheduling needs to be done optimally to achieve proficient results in a cloud computing environment. While satisfying the user’s requirements in a cloud environment, scheduling has been proven an NP-hard problem. Therefore, it leaves scope to develop new allocation models for the problem. The aim of the study is to develop load balancing method to maximize the resource utilization in cloud environment.

Design/methodology/approach

In this paper, the parallelized task allocation with load balancing (PTAL) hybrid heuristic is proposed for jobs coming from various users. These jobs are allocated on the resources one by one in a parallelized manner as they arrive in the cloud system. The novel algorithm works in three phases: parallelization, task allocation and task reallocation. The proposed model is designed for efficient task allocation, reallocation of resources and adequate load balancing to achieve better quality of service (QoS) results.

Findings

The acquired empirical results show that PTAL performs better than other scheduling strategies under various cases for different QoS parameters under study.

Originality/value

The outcome has been examined for the real data set to evaluate it with different state-of-the-art heuristics having comparable objective parameters.

Abstract

Purpose

The objectives of the study were to identify the effects of blockchain technology (BT) on the university librarians, the impact of BT on the university library services and to reveal the challenges to adopt BT in the university libraries.

Design/methodology/approach

A systematic literature review was applied to address the objectives of the study. Around 25 studies published in peer-reviewed journals were selected to conduct the study.

Findings

The findings of the study revealed that blockchain technology (BT) has positive effects on the university librarians as it assists them in digital resources management, provision of integrated library services, effective records management and continued professional development. The study also displayed that BT has a positive impact on the university libraries through effective information management, user privacy, collaboration, technological innovation and access control. Results also revealed that technical issues, financial constraints, security problems, skill issues and sociocultural issues created challenges to adopt BT in the university libraries.

Originality/value

The study has offered theoretical implications for future investigators through the provision of innovative literature on the prospectus and challenges associated with blockchain in the context of librarianship. The study has also provided practical implications for management bodies by offering recommendations for the successful adoption of blockchain in the university libraries. Additionally, a framework has been developed to adopt BT successfully in the university libraries for the delivery of smart library services to library patrons.

Abstract

Purpose

The purpose of this paper is to study the correlational and effect relationship between Halal standards and the performance of Halal-certified Palestinian Food Companies.

Design/methodology/approach

Quantitative method was used, using a questionnaire survey of 40 Halal-certified Palestinian organizations out of a total of 47 certified organizations, the analysis was done using the partial least squares structural equation modeling (PLS-SEM) and the literature review was conducted using a well-known systematic literature review methodology.

Findings

Halal implementation and certification had a positive impact on performance (operational, financial and marketing). The depth/intensity of implementation fully mediates operational performance and partially mediates marketing and financial performance.

Research limitations/implications

As the sample size is small, it is recommended to conduct the study using a larger sample size, once the number of Palestinian Halal-certified organizations increases. A longitudinal or panel study is recommended to capture data that are more accurate and avoid objectivity and bias issues using a cross-sectional research design method. Finally, the study recommends to conduct additional research in the field of Halal awareness for customers to gage their intention and welling to buy Halal products within the Middle East region.

Originality/value

The importance of this study exists in the lack of previous Halal-related studies in the Palestinian context and the previously described gap in the literature. Nevertheless, the quality management drivers and impact are limited in the Palestinian context compared with other contexts; the results of the previously published studies revealed mixed results such as the drivers of quality management are based on the type of business. Finally, this research gives small insights and directions toward conducting additional studies concerning customer awareness about Halal products.

Abstract

Purpose

The purpose of this paper is to analyse the relationship between foreign direct investment (FDI) inflows and economic growth with a special focus on the institutional environment at the state level. FDI-led economic growth and economic growth-led FDI have two dominant theoretical foundations, but empirical research supports contradictory findings. These perspectives largely ignore the institutional environment, assuming institutions to be background information.

Design/methodology/approach

To examine the causal relationship between FDI, the Granger causality method has been used. The impact of FDI inflows and other institutional factors on economic growth has been examined using the panel data regression method. The principal component analysis (PCA) method has also been used to develop indexes for some variables.

Findings

Results indicate a two-way Granger causality between FDI inflows and economic growth at the state level. Infrastructures, education expenses, labour availability and gross fixed-capital formation (GFCF) are positive and significant determinants, whilst corruption and FDI inflows are leaving negative impact on state-wise economic growth.

Originality/value

This study contributes to the body of the literature in four different ways: first, it empirically examines the trends and patterns of subnational FDI inflow and economic growth disparity in India; second, it examines the causality between FDI and economic growth. Third, with the institution-based paradigm in international business, it investigates how institutional variables affect the expansion of the economy. Fourth, it extends prior research by examining the link at the state level using a large panel data set made up of 29 states and 7 union territories (UTs) over the years 2000–2019.
